Window Leaks

Window leaks can cause water damage to your home. Untreated, they can damage electrical connections, walls, and floors. Close  double glazing repairs bromley  and doors and switch on exhaust fans if you suspect a leak. With an incense stick or candle, you could move flames or smoke around the fenestrations, if you see any signs of smoke or flame coming through it is likely there is an issue that needs to be addressed.

It is not unusual for windows to break, especially in older homes. The most frequent reason is condensation between glass panes, or broken seals. This can cause water to accumulate within the window's frame that will then be able to leak into your home. Poor installation or damaged caulking are additional reasons for windows to leak.

Caulking that is damaged can be replaced to repair window leaks. This is simple to do and takes only about a couple of minutes. Hardware stores usually sell inexpensive tubes of caulk. First, take the old caulking from around the window and scrape off any material that is degrading. Then, apply the new caulking. Examine the drainage holes at the bottom of the frame to ensure they're not blocked up by dirt or other debris. It is also important that the sill pan slopes away from the window to prevent water from accumulating on the frame and result in leaks.

Condensation

Condensation on the inside of your double glazing indicates that the space is not adequately ventilated. You can fix this by opening your windows or using dehumidifiers. The condensation outside your window is an indication of a damaged sealed unit. In this situation, you should contact a double-glazing repair business to repair or replace the unit.

Poor Seals


Window seals are a necessary component of keeping your home comfortable, but they're also susceptible to damage. This can lead to various issues, from leaking to cracked glass. It's essential to repair them as soon you notice any indication of a damaged window seal.

Condensation of the glass panes in your windows is a typical indication that the window seal has failed. This is because the seal is broken and allowing moisture from outside to get through. This can cause fog to build up on your windows. The condition can get worse over time because the humidity levels fluctuate. Window repairs in Bromley could make your windows better insulation level, thereby saving you money and making your home more energy efficient.

Double-paned windows have a filling of inert gas (typically argon or krypton) between the two panes of glass, which is designed to increase their insulation efficiency. When the seal fails and the gas that insulates your window is released, it can escape, reducing your window's effectiveness.

Window seals are prone to wear naturally over time, but they can be affected by other factors like poor installation of windows or pressure on the glass caused by house movement. It is also possible that something went wrong in the process of manufacturing that could have a negative impact on the performance of the seal. If this is the situation the warranty will cover the cost to replace it.
